Alicia Keys

Alicia Keys, born Alicia Augello Cook on January 25, 1981, is an American singer, songwriter, and classically trained pianist. She started composing music at age 12 and signed her first record deal at 15. With the release of her debut album "Songs in A Minor" in 2001, Keys achieved global acclaim and commercial success, including the hit single "Fallin" and five Grammy Awards. She continued her success with albums like "The Diary of Alicia Keys," "As I Am," and "Girl on Fire," earning multiple chart-topping singles and additional Grammy honors. Beyond music, Alicia Keys has made an impact as an actress, Broadway composer, and philanthropist. She co-founded the charity Keep a Child Alive, focusing on HIV/AIDS awareness. With over 90 million records sold worldwide, Keys is recognized as one of the best-selling music artists of her generation. Her influence is reflected in numerous industry awards and honors from outlets like Billboard, VH1, and Time. Throughout her career, Keys has stood out for her musical talent, advocacy, and commitment to social causes.
